Doing An Effective Car Wash Yourself

By Francine Balin

Most of the people love their automobile so much that not only do they want to keep it in the best condition but also glittering just like a new one, even after years of purchasing it. If you are one of them, you need to ensure that your car is not only properly cared for through regular servicing but also gets a regular car wash.

All it takes for a good self car wash is the right accessories and some easy to execute steps as discussed below. First, begin with a brisk hose down of your car to remove most of the dust and grime. Now begin soaping the roof with a good car wash shampoo.

It is recommended not to use the detergents from the kitchen, even if they work well with all your greasy utensils. They can result in abrasion of car wax and leave your vehicle devoid of its real lustre and shine. There are a lot of good car soaps available in the market, just make sure to pick a high quality one.

Make sure the sponge that you are using is fairly new and clean, otherwise you might just end up adding more grime on your vehicle than you take away from it. You should use micro fibre mitts to ensure that you don't wear away the sparkle with your rubbing.

Once you have washed the roof, go through the same process with the hood, the rear and sides in that order. When you are certain that you have soaped and scrubbed to your heart's content, use the water hose once again to wash off the vehicle thoroughly. After this, your vehicle still needs a little more to be done to gleam and shine again.

Leaving your car in the sun after just having cleaned it will cause water marks all over the body of the car. Therefore, you must use chamois leather to wipe it properly so that it shines with a new found lustre.
